Sagespring Wealth Partners LLC raised its stake in shares of American Express (NYSE:AXP) by 21.7%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The firm owned 16,265 shares of the payment services company's stock after purchasing an additional 2,905 shares during the period. Sagespring Wealth Partners LLC's holdings in American Express were worth $4,376,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

American Express Trading Down 3.5%
Shares of NYSE:AXP opened at $287.62 on Monday. American Express has a 12-month low of $220.43 and a 12-month high of $326.28. The business's fifty day simple moving average is $278.89 and its 200-day simple moving average is $288.83. The company has a market capitalization of $201.50 billion, a PE ratio of 20.53, a P/E/G ratio of 1.41 and a beta of 1.25. The company has a current ratio of 1.58, a quick ratio of 1.57 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.64.
American Express (NYSE:AXP -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 17th. The payment services company reported $3.64 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$3.47 by $0.17. The firm had revenue of $16.97 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$17.04 billion. American Express had a return on equity of 32.65% and a net margin of 15.36%.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$3.33 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ts predict that American Express will post 15.33 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

American Express Profile
(
Free Report)
American Express Company, together with its subsidiaries, operates as integrated payments company in the United States, Europe, the Middle East and Africa, the Asia Pacific, Australia, New Zealand, Latin America, Canada, the Caribbean, and Internationally. It operates through four segments: U.S. Consumer Services, Commercial Services, International Card Services, and Global Merchant and Network Services.
